Recurring Remote Production Support Graphics Interface Coordinator (GIC)

A-Recurring-Remote-Production-Support-Graphics-Interface-Coordinator-(GIC)-manages-the-creation-and-real-time-execution-of-on-air-scoreboard-graphics-(Score-Bug/Clock-and-Score)-and-content-during-live-sports-broadcasts-across-ESPN-platforms.-This-role-ensures-accurate,-timely-display-of-live-game-information-including-but-not-limited-to-score,-time,-penalties,-team/player-statistics,-and-any-other-pertinent-information-while-troubleshooting-systems-and-coordinating-closely-with-production-teams.-This-requires-the-ability-to-be-able-to-react-quickly-to-game-action-as-well-as-follow-along-with-the-production-crew-to-help-show-the-story-lines-of-the-game.-Additionally,-the-GIC-must-have-strong-computer-networking-and-troubleshooting-skills,-advanced-knowledge-of-sports-rules-and-scoring-systems,-and-the-ability-to-operate-and-interface-multiple-scoring-platforms-in-a-live-broadcast-setting.-This-role-is-remote-based-without-a-corporate-office-location.

Responsibilities:

  • Enter-scoring-data-quickly-and-accurately-including-any-additional-content-appearing-as-part-of-the-Score-Bug/Clock-and-Score.-This-may-include-showing-a-wide-range-of-statistical,-team,-or-game-reset-information-as-dictated-by-the-game-action-and-production-team.
  • Work-closely-with-Producer-and-Associate-Producer-on-building-interface-graphics.
  • Work-with-the-Operations-and-Technical-Teams-to-properly-check-Score-Bug-equipment-prior-to-going-live-on-air-(check-comms,-tallies,-and-ensure-score-bug-fires-up-and-displays-on-screen).
  • The-ability-to-assemble-and-network-multiple-computer-scoring-systems.
  • Troubleshoot-system-problems-and-provide-quick-diagnosis-and-resolution.
  • Connect-to-stadium-in-house-scoreboard-for-clock-and-data-transfer-when-applicable.
  • Send-Software-Engineering-team-detailed-post-game-reports-after-every-event.
